Taiwan ordinary passport holders do NOT need a traditional visa for a short tourist trip to Israel, but since 1 January 2025 they MUST obtain an ETA-IL (Electronic Travel Authorization) online before departure. It costs ILS 25, is valid up to 2 years for multiple entries, and permits stays of up to 90 days. Taiwan is a visa-exempt country for Israel, so no consular visa is required for tourism, business, or short visits of up to 90 days. However, Israel's Population and Immigration Authority (PIBA) launched the mandatory ETA-IL electronic travel authorization, which became compulsory for all visa-exempt nationalities (including Taiwan) on 1 January 2025 and remains in force through 2026. Taiwan ordinary passport holders must apply online via the official PIBA portal (israel-entry.piba.gov.il) before travel. The ETA-IL is linked to the passport, costs ILS 25 (about USD 7), is generally valid for 2 years (or until the passport expires, whichever comes first) and allows multiple entries with stays of up to 90 days each. Authorities recommend applying at least 72 hours before departure, ideally before booking flights and hotels; most decisions arrive within a few hours to 72 hours by email. The traveler must carry the approved ETA-IL together with a passport valid for at least 6 months. Israel is not in the Schengen Area, so Schengen 90/180 and ETIAS rules do not apply. Final admission is always at the discretion of the Israeli border officer.
